About The Role

Support the HSSEQ Document Governance team in delivering high-quality, audience-appropriate documentation. Responsibilities focus on administrative and document production activities, ensuring consistency in document structure, formatting, and version control.

Formatting and Word Processing ( Primary Focus )

  • Format a variety of HSSEQ documents, including but not limited to policies, procedures, guidelines, work instructions, job safety analyses (JSAs), workflow diagrams, and forms.
  • Use approved and branded templates to ensure consistency in layout, structure, and presentation prior to publication.
  • Proofread and format documents prior to publication to ensure quality and consistency.
  • Ensure consistency in document structure, formatting, and visual presentation.
  • Support quality checks to ensure documents are polished and professional.
  • Apply advanced/proficient level Microsoft Word and word processing skills, including effective use of styles, headings, pagination, tables, and cross-referencing.
  • Demonstrate working knowledge of Excel, PowerPoint, SharePoint, and Teams.

Document Administration and Control

  • Apply document control practices to ensure HSSEQ documentation is properly maintained and version-controlled.
  • Assign and maintain document numbers and revision numbers in accordance with established document control conventions.
  • Track document updates and revisions, as required.
  • Maintain organized document folders within Teams/SharePoint environment with original and revised versions properly identified.
  • Ensure documents are proofread and formatted in both languages in alignment with document update schedules.

Translation: (English ↔ French support)

  • Provide initial English-to-French translation support for bilingual document readiness.
  • Note: Microsoft Copilot can be used to create or assist with first-pass translation. A member of the HSSEQ team will do final review and verification of translation.
  • Ensure translated documents are properly formatted and aligned with the source language.
  • Support quality checks to maintain consistency across documents in both languages.
